Unpacking Her Political Journey Alright, let’s kick things off by really getting to know Lauren Boebert herself. Before she became a lightning rod for MSNBC and other liberal media outlets, she was a small business owner in Rifle, Colorado. Her entry into politics wasn’t through traditional channels; it was a grassroots movement, fueled by a strong conservative platform and a vocal stance on issues like gun rights and government overreach. She famously challenged a sitting Republican incumbent in 2020 and won, launching her onto the national stage. Boebert’s appeal to her base is undeniable: she speaks directly, without much filter, embodying a certain kind of anti-establishment, pro-freedom ethos that resonates deeply with many voters, particularly in rural America. Her political journey is marked by a rapid ascent from relative obscurity to a prominent, often controversial, voice in the Republican party. She quickly aligned herself with the more conservative wing of the GOP, becoming a vocal proponent of policies that emphasize individual liberty, limited government, and a strict interpretation of constitutional rights. From the moment she stepped onto the national stage, Lauren Boebert made it clear she wasn’t going to be a quiet backbencher. She’s been involved in numerous high-profile debates, from questioning election integrity to advocating for Second Amendment rights, and her unapologetic style has consistently put her in the national spotlight. Her early political career also saw her quickly embrace social media as a powerful tool, using platforms like Twitter to communicate directly with her supporters and challenge her critics, often bypassing traditional media gatekeepers.
